“Ready Player Two” is a science fiction novel written by American author Ernest Cline. It is the sequel to Cline’s highly successful debut novel, “Ready Player One,” which was published in 2011. “Ready Player Two” was published in November 2020.

The story of “Ready Player Two” continues to explore the virtual reality world of the OASIS, which is a vast and immersive virtual universe where much of society spends their time. In this sequel, the main character, Wade Watts (also known as Parzival), and his friends once again find themselves embroiled in a high-stakes adventure within the OASIS.

The plot revolves around the discovery of a new technology called the ONI (OASIS Neural Interface), which allows users to experience the OASIS with all five of their senses. This breakthrough technology has the potential to revolutionize the virtual world, but it also presents new challenges and dangers. Wade and his friends must race against time to unravel the mysteries of the ONI and prevent it from falling into the wrong hands.

As in the first book, “Ready Player Two” is filled with references to 1980s pop culture, video games, and science fiction, making it a nostalgic journey for fans of that era. The novel also explores themes related to technology, virtual reality, and the consequences of living in an increasingly digital world.

While “Ready Player Two” received attention and generated interest due to its connection to the popular first book and the film adaptation of “Ready Player One,” opinions about the sequel have been mixed, with some readers enjoying the continuation of the story and others finding it less compelling than the original.

Overall, “Ready Player Two” offers a blend of science fiction, adventure, and pop culture nostalgia, and it appeals to readers who enjoy stories set in virtual worlds and those who appreciate references to geek and gaming culture.
